Libao Shi (SM’2009) received the Ph.D. degree from the department of Electrical Engineering, Chongqing University, Chongqing, China, in 2000. He is currently an associate professor of the Shenzhen International Graduate School, Tsinghua University, Shenzhen, China. His research interests include complementary and coordinated dispatch technologies with multi-energy source structure; risk assessment in cyber-physical power systems; power system- cascading failure and restoration control; computational intelligence and its application in smart grid; power system dynamics.
